Biography

Scott Billington is a three-time Grammy winner who has produced recordings by such esteemed artists as Charlie Rich, Bobby Rush, and Irma Thomas. While he has been writing short pieces such as magazine articles and album liner notes since he was a teenager, his first book was Making Tracks—a memoir that includes in-depth profiles of many of the legendary musicians with whom he worked and the varying challenges of making a great record.
